Identifying common ground When deploying heterogeneous architecture, especially in multicloud environments, organizations must aggressively reduce silos. This means establishing common control planes for security, governance, and operations. You won’t get there by relying on whatever proprietary technology each cloud provider offers out of the box. Each provider wants you locked into their way of managing things. That is fine for simple deployments, but when you are running across multiple clouds and on-premises systems, proprietary control planes introduce redundancy, complexity, and cost. You need a single control layer that spans your entire environment. Instead of managing 10 different security solutions from 10 different providers, you have one. Instead of separate identity management systems for each cloud, you need one that works everywhere. This eliminates the need to change security parameters in five different consoles, maintain five different skill sets for five different operational models, and reconcile five different governance frameworks. The common control plane ties everything together. This might sound hard, but it’s not as bad as you think. (I will cover the specific patterns in a future article.) The real issue is that most architects have never been trained to think this way. They were taught to select the best services from each provider rather than abstract away the differences. This fundamental gap costs organizations real money every single day. Cost observability and optimization Most architects treat cost visibility and optimization as afterthoughts, things that can be bolted on after the architecture is in place. That backward approach shows up in the results. Without cost observability and optimization baked into your architecture from day one, you cannot understand where your money is going, where waste is accumulating, or where you should make changes to align expenses with delivered value. The more complex and heterogeneous your environment, the more critical this becomes. You need a unified cost observability layer that spans public and private clouds and your own infrastructure. This is about building a layer that aggregates cost data from everywhere, provides a single source of truth for spending, and delivers the insights needed to actively optimize. Without this, you are flying blind, making decisions based on incomplete data and discovering problems only after the invoice arrives. Too many organizations fail to gain control of their cloud spending because their billing data is scattered across multiple consoles, with no way to correlate usage across providers. They cannot see which teams, projects, or services are driving costs. They miss opportunities to right-size, consolidate, or eliminate waste. You cannot improve what you cannot measure. Without a common cost observability and optimization layer built into your architecture, you will never achieve the efficiency the cloud was supposed to deliver. Consider the human element Here is an uncomfortable truth most architects do not want to discuss: The more complex your architecture is, the broader the range of skills you will need to keep it running. Complexity requires expertise, and expertise requires hiring, training, and retention. If your architecture demands 15 different skill sets to operate, you’d better have a plan for finding and retaining the people with those skills. I have seen beautifully designed architectures fail because the organization could not meet hiring requirements. They compromised by hiring underqualified individuals, which led to operational failures, security gaps, and mounting technical debt. The architecture itself was sound. The human infrastructure around it was not. This is a solvable problem. It starts with acknowledging that you are not designing for yourself. You are designing for the team that will inherit this system after you have moved on to your next assignment or promotion. The solution isn’t just simplifying architecture, though that should be a goal. The key is to consider human factors in your design. What skills are required? How can you find and train people? What cultural changes are necessary for effective operation? These questions are essential; ignoring them risks failure.
